size-limited-queue VS semaphore go

Compare size-limited-queue vs semaphore go and see what are their differences.

InfluxDB - Power Real-Time Data Analytics at Scale
Get real-time insights from all types of time series data with InfluxDB. Ingest, query, and analyze billions of data points in real-time with unbounded cardinality.
www.influxdata.com
featured
SaaSHub - Software Alternatives and Reviews
SaaSHub helps you find the best software and product alternatives
www.saashub.com
featured
size-limited-queue semaphore go
1 -
24 166
- -
0.0 0.0
over 2 years ago about 3 years ago
Go Go
MIT License MIT License
The number of mentions indicates the total number of mentions that we've tracked plus the number of user suggested alternatives.
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.

size-limited-queue

Posts with mentions or reviews of size-limited-queue. We have used some of these posts to build our list of alternatives and similar projects. The last one was on 2021-04-12.
  • I wrote a blog article to understand "sync.Cond"
    2 projects | /r/golang | 12 Apr 2021
    I tried my best to explain what sync.Cond is, how it is used, why we want to prefer it rather than mutex... with a concrete and working example. Example repo is found here: https://github.com/dty1er/size-limited-queue

semaphore go

Posts with mentions or reviews of semaphore go. We have used some of these posts to build our list of alternatives and similar projects.

We haven't tracked posts mentioning semaphore go yet.
Tracking mentions began in Dec 2020.

What are some alternatives?

When comparing size-limited-queue and semaphore go you can also consider the following projects:

go-deadlock - Online deadlock detection in go (golang)

go-waitgroup - A sync.WaitGroup with error handling and concurrency control

go-left-right - A faster RWLock primitive in Go, 2-3 times faster than RWMutex. A Go implementation of concurrency control algorithm in paper <Left-Right - A Concurrency Control Technique with Wait-Free Population Oblivious Reads>

workerpool - Go simple async worker pool

grpool - Lightweight Goroutine pool

pool - :speedboat: a limited consumer goroutine or unlimited goroutine pool for easier goroutine handling and cancellation

goworker - goworker is a Go-based background worker that runs 10 to 100,000* times faster than Ruby-based workers.

threadpool - Golang simple thread pool implementation

semaphore - 🚦 Semaphore pattern implementation with timeout of lock/unlock operations.

parallel-fn - Run functions in parallel :comet:

ants - 🐜🐜🐜 ants is a high-performance and low-cost goroutine pool in Go./ ants ζ˜―δΈ€δΈͺι«˜ζ€§θƒ½δΈ”δ½ŽζŸθ€—ηš„ goroutine 池。

Goflow - Simply way to control goroutines execution order based on dependencies